Job Description Summary The AI Foundry delivers AI capabilities for internal productivity, working closely with all business units across the company to serve their needs. As a Director of the AI software engineering group, you will lead the delivery of AI capabilities and applications from internal development teams and third parties. This role is heavily focused on executing and delivering AI software solutions on time, within budget and scope, and to the required quality standards. This role bridges partner execution, strategy, business needs, data science and operations to move AI solutions from concept to production. You’ll partner with product managers, AI software engineers, and security teams to ship reliable, compliant solutions while building a strong development culture. Expect to influence strategy, provide leadership in execution, shape standards and deliver AI solutions that make an impact. If you’re unsure, apply. Job Description This role requires an expert-level grasp of trade-offs involving delivery of Agentic AI solutions on Cloud infrastructure. You will develop and manage high-performing engineers and organize a large group of contractors to deliver on scope, quality and time. You will manage a growing group of full-time employees and contractors focused on delivery. You will be responsible for researching and rolling out the latest technologies and methodologies adopted from industry - wide practices to deliver software using AI techniques. Provide day - to - day work direction for team members engaged in projects and delivery. You will actively present leadership updates to GE Vernova executives and internal customers. You’ll work with others to define future technology rollout and architecture for products and services. Quickly learn, internalize and develop a strong understanding of key priorities and how to map them to execution plans. You’ll be expected to align with stakeholders to ensure that data and process changes required in systems are implemented in accordance with project objectives and timelines. Facilitate and coach software engineering teams on requirements estimation and work sizing . Drive a continuous learning culture to help guide continuous improvements. Provide leadership on Lean/Agile principles and development practices. Utilize tools to track progress, identify key risk areas for specific implementations, and assist in resolving conflicting priorities through proactive communication with stakeholders about requirements and timelines. Operate as an engaged AI leader who serves as a subject matter expert and technical expert for assigned programs and development initiatives. Work with system leaders and functional teams to ensure products and services adhere to compliance and controllership standards. The AI Foundry builds AI solutions behind GE Vernova’s internal AI productivity applications. We are the owners and advocates of internal AI usage within the company. We deliver our applications using the principles of responsible AI and drive the pace of innovation. We look across the company for reuse, break down technical barriers and drive collaboration with our business partners. We have a mandate to deliver bottom-line impact , and this role is key to achieving that outcome. Minimum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or a STEM field (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ics), with significant experience. 15 years of experience in software engineering, with 8 years in a technical engineering, systems architecture, or principal-level role. 5+ years of experience leading and managing software engineering organizations. Cloud SaaS delivery experience Experience delivering commercial software products. Experience shipping AI applications with cost management. Education Qualification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or a STEM field (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ics), with significant experience. Preferred Characteristics Experience managing other engineering managers. Demonstrated ability to engage, influence, and collaborate with senior executive stakeholders (VPs, Directors) across multiple distinct business units. Proven track record of leading large, complex, cross-functional engineering organizations with large groups of contractors in a high-growth, fast-paced environment. Experience deploying RAG pipelines in production environments. Strong systems - level thinking in decision - making and problem - solving . Experience working in global organizations. Experience with serverless technologies; including AWS AgentCore and Langchain. Experience working with AWS services and cloud platforms.
